Identical triplets, also known as monozygotic triplets, occur when a single fertilized egg splits into three separate embryos. This phenomenon is extremely rare and occurs in approximately 1 in every 200,000 births. The odds of conceiving identical triplets are quite low, but they do happen in some cases due to a variety of factors.
